9 shot Analysis

Memento

Page 2: 9 shot

Close up shot on a polaroid pictured , framed by a hand at the left hand side, the close up shot emphasis on the blood in the image . From this shot us as an audience can tell that there has been crime and violence included within this sequence.

Page 3: 9 shot

Extreme close up on the hands of the character , this shot shows movement of the hands which can portray into stress or being nervous which suggests that there is something out of the ordinary occurred in this sequence.

Page 4: 9 shot

Close up shot on the face of the character, this shot follows on from the shot of the hands. The effect of the close up shot is to show the blood on the characters face and the nervous sweat running down his right cheek, again this shot definitely portrays that there is something out of the ordinary occurred. Example a crime of murder.

Page 5: 9 shot

Extreme close up shot on blood running, the effect of this shot is to tell the audience that there has been violence or a murder in this film, but by just using a close up shot on the blood and not a shot of the body creates a suspense for the viewer to keep watching to find out what has happened.

Page 6: 9 shot

Again another closer up shot is used on the case of the the bullet which is another clue that a crime has been made. This shot uses a shallow focus has the background behind the bullet is not in focus, the effect of this is to portray the how he mind of the murderer is not clear for them to commit a crime like this.

Page 7: 9 shot

Close up shot on a pair of glasses covered in blood, the blood conotates as death , and the glasses are used as a clue to the type of person the character is that has been murdered or hurt. The continuous use of close up shots is to create a mystery for the audience so they get an insight on what has happened without knowing.

Page 8: 9 shot

Birds eye view close up on the victims head. Very dark saturation making the shot look more mysterious. Typical convention of a film noir style is used in this shot using shadows and strips of light to make the shot seem more dated. The splatters of blood frame the head of the victim in this shot which is a clear connotation of a murder.

Page 9: 9 shot

Medium shot of the criminal from a low angle makes him look more dominant and in control , The gun is pointed at the camera in this shot which makes it look like the audience is looking through the eyes of the victim making them fell small an vulnerable making this an effective shot.

Page 10: 9 shot

This shot is an extreme close up on the face showing the facial expressions focusing on the eye to show emotion in the character. This shot is in black and white which expresses the shadow convention of a film noir as the strip of light , highlights the eye to express the way he is feeling. Showing the emotion and sadness in his face.
